1. 🔩 The Damage Is Cosmetic, Not Structural
If something still works but just doesn’t look great, you’re probably looking at a repair—not a replacement.
Examples:
- A door with scuffs, scratches, or chipped paint? A little sanding and a fresh coat of paint can make it look brand new.
- Cabinets with loose hinges or worn handles? We can tighten, adjust, or swap out hardware for a quick facelift.
- A deck with weathered boards? Often, only a few planks need replacing—not the whole structure.
🧰 Handyman Tip: Cosmetic issues are often the easiest and most affordable to fix. Don’t toss out a perfectly good fixture just because it’s lost its shine—we can help bring it back to life.
2. 🪚 The Core Structure Is Still Sound
Whether it’s a fence, a piece of furniture, or a porch railing, if the bones are still good, there’s no need to start from scratch.
Examples:
- A wobbly handrail might just need reinforcement—not a full rebuild.
- A sagging gate could be fixed with a new hinge or post adjustment.
- A cracked tile floor may only need a few tiles replaced, not a full re-tiling.
💡 Why It Matters: Replacing an entire structure when only a small part is failing can be costly and wasteful. Repairs let you preserve the integrity of your home while saving money.

3. 🧱 It’s a Quality Piece That’s Built to Last
Older homes and fixtures often have something newer ones don’t: craftsmanship. If you’ve got a solid wood door, a cast iron tub, or a hand-built cabinet, it’s worth preserving.
Examples:
- A vintage front door with character? We can fix the frame, refinish the surface, and keep that charm intact.
- Hardwood floors with scratches? A sanding and refinish job can restore their original beauty.
- Original trim or molding? We can patch and paint without losing the historic detail.
🪵 Handyman Insight: They don’t make ’em like they used to. If you’ve got something well-made, it’s almost always worth repairing. We love helping homeowners preserve the character of their homes.
4. 💸 The Cost of Repair Is Significantly Lower Than Replacement
This one’s a no-brainer, but it’s often overlooked. If a repair costs a fraction of what a replacement would, and it’ll extend the life of the item for years, it’s usually the smarter move.
Examples:
- A leaky faucet? A new washer or cartridge can fix it for a few bucks—no need for a whole new fixture.
- A broken step on a staircase? We can replace the tread without rebuilding the entire flight.
- A malfunctioning ceiling fan? Sometimes it’s just a loose wire or a bad switch.
📉 Budget-Friendly Bonus: Repairs often take less time and cause less disruption than full replacements. That means fewer headaches for you and your family.
5. 🕰️ You’re Not Ready for a Full Renovation (Yet)
Sometimes, a repair is the perfect stopgap. Maybe you’re planning a bigger remodel down the road, or you just need things to hold up for a few more years. A well-done repair can buy you time without sacrificing safety or comfort.
Examples:
- Your deck is due for a full rebuild next year, but a few loose boards need attention now.
- Your kitchen cabinets aren’t your dream style, but fixing a broken drawer keeps things functional until you’re ready to renovate.
- Your siding has a few damaged panels, but a full replacement isn’t in the budget this season.
🧭 Smart Strategy: Repairs can help you prioritize your home improvement goals without feeling overwhelmed. We’ll help you make a plan that works for your timeline and your wallet.
